182396. lajstromszámú szabadalom • Eljárás és berendezés központi egység független memóriarendszer architektura kialakítására

7 182396 8 tül összekötött 23b átalakító részegysége, továbbá 23c címátalakító részegysége és 23d adatátalakító részegysé­ge van. A 23a vezérlő részegység, a 23c címátalakító részegység és a 23d adatátalakító részegység rendre a belső központi C vezetékköteg részét képező belső ve­zérlő Cl vezetékkötegre, belső cím C2 vezetékkötegre és a belső adat C3 vezetékkötegre csatlakozik. A 23b . átalakító részegység, a. 23c címátalakító .részegység és az 23d adatátalakító „részegység rendre az egységes köz-, ponti B vezetékköteg részét képező egységes vezérlő Bl. vezetékkötegre, az egységes cím B2 vezetékkötegre és az egységes adat B3 vezetékkötegre van kötve. A 23c cím­átalakító részegység ki/bemenetei a cím kiegészítő G vezetékkötegen keresztül a 23a vezérlő részegységre, ki­menete pedig az adat vezérlő H vezetékkötegen keresz­tül a, 23d adatátalakító részegység bemenetére van csat­lakoztatva. Mivel a számítógép központi A vezetékkötege meg­egyezhet az egységes központi B vezetékköteggel,.vagy legalábbis ahhoz hasonló, mindkét A, B vezetékköteg­nél az adat vezetékek száma 16 a cím vezetékek száma 16—18, ezért a 21 tároló és átalakító egység és a 23 át­alakító egység működése sok tekintetben megegyezik, ezért a 23 átalakító egység egyes részeinek működését csak ott ismertetjük részletesebben, ahol eltér a 21 tároló és átalakító egységtől. A 23d adatátalakító részegység feladata megegyezik a 21d gyors tároló részegységével, azzal a különbséggel, hogy nem tartalmaz gyors tárolót csak adatátalakítást végez a belső adat Ç3 és az egységes adat B3 vezetékkötegek között. A 23c címátalakító részegység működése megegyezik a 21c címbővítő részegység működésével, azzal a kü­lönbséggel, hogy a 23d adatátalakító részegység szarná- ' ra, mivel az tárolót nem tartalmaz, csak az adat átala­kításhoz szükséges vezérlő jeleket állít elő, azon kívül, hogy illeszti a B2 és a C2 vezetékkötegeket. A 23b átalakító részegység működése teljes egészében megegyezik a 21a átalakító részegység működésével. Abban az esetben, ha az A és a B vezetékkötegek meg­egyeznek a 21a átalakító.és a 23b. átalakító részegységek is megegyeznek — teljesen azonosak. A 23a vezérlő részegység működése megegyezik a 21b vezérlő részegység működésével. A találmány egy további példakénti kiviteli.alakját ugyancsak a 3. ábra alapján ismertetjük, mely a koráb­biaktól abban tér el, hogy az egységes 22 memóriát ki­részleteztük. Az egységes 22 memóriának első, második és n-edik 22a,b—n memória tömbje van. A 22a—n me­mória tömbök bernenetei a belső központi C vezeték­köteg részét képező belső vezérlő-, és belső cím Cl, C2 vezetékkötegre, ki/bemenetei pedig az ugyancsak a belső központi C vezetékköteg részét képező belső adat C3 vezetékkötegre vannak kötve. Az egyes 22a n memó­ria tömbök felépítésüket tekintve teljes. egészében meg­egyeznek. A cím tartományt, hogy milyen címekén szó­laljanak meg „jumperekkel”, azaz kapcsolókkal lehet beállítani, ily módon tetszés szerinti memória nagyság alakítható ki 4 M kapacitásig— 4 M=222 = 4 194 304, vagyis a memória maximális tároló kapacitása 4 194 304 szó, vagy byte, aszerint, hogy a számítógép szó vagy byte szervezésű, . Összefoglalva : a találmány szerinti eljárás és beren­dezés alkalmazásával a számítógép családok a hard­ware kompatíbilissá tehetők, ezzel együtt nő a memória­­kapacitásuk, teljesítő képességük és sebességük, továbbá a hardware bővíthetőségük is, amennyiben a háttér me­móriákat közvetlenül a belső központi vezetékkötegre kapcsoljuk. A már működő számítógép konfigurációk esetén a ta­lálmány szerinti eljárást és berendezést alkalmazva, oly módon, hogy a számítógép központi vezetékkötegét fel­vágjuk és a berendezést közbeiktatjuk, megnövekszik a számítógépes konfiguráció maximális kapacitása, bővít­­hetőbbé válik hardware eszközök tekintetében a rend­szer, és egyben megnő a sebessége. Abban az esetben, ha a központi egység blokkos műveletek elvégzésére nem vagy csak részben volt alkalmas a berendezés alkalma­zása előtt úgy a végrehajtható feladatok köre is kibővül. A találmány alkalmazása túl azon, hogy a számítógép családok, illetve az egyes gépek műszaki paramétereit jelentősen javítják — megnövelik — csökkentik a hard­ware tervezési költségeket azáltal, hogy az egyes gép­típusok illesztő egységeit csak egyszer kell megtervezni — megszünteti a párhuzamos tervezéseket. Szabadalmi igénypontok , 1. Eljárás központi egység független memóriarend­szer architektúra kialakítására számítógép családokhoz, azzal jellemezve, hogy a számítógép család bármelyik számítógép központi vezetékkötegén érkező vezérlő és cím jeleket átalakítjuk egy belső központi vezetékköteg jeleivé, majd ismételten átalakítjuk egy egységes köz­ponti vezetékköteg jeleivé, a számítógép központi ve­zetékköteg adat jeleit ugyancsak átalakítjuk a belső köz­ponti vezetékköteg adatjeleivé, de ezzel egyidejűleg egy gyors tárolóra is vezetjük, majd ezután a belső központi vezetékköteg adatjeleit újra átalakítjuk az egységes köz­ponti vezetékköteg számára, egy egységes memóriát kapcsolunk a belső központi vezetékkötegre. 2. Az 1. igénypont szerinti eljárás foganatosítási mód­ja, azzal jellemezve, hogy a belső központi vézetékköteg adatvonalainak számát úgy választjuk meg, hogy a szá­mítógép, illetve az egységes központi adat vézetékköte­­geinél nagyobb legyen, előnyösen kétszerese. 3. A 2. igénypont szerinti eljárás foganatosítási mód­ja, azzal jellemezve, hogy a belső központi vezetékköte­gen az adatokat úgy sűrítjük, hogy az adatforgalmi idők­ben szünet, úgynevezett szabad időköz álljon be, például kétszeres adat vezetékköteg szám esetén a két adatot egymás mellett továbbítva minden második a számító­gép, illetve az egységes központi vezetékkötegen zajló adatátvitel alatt szabad időközöket hozunk létre. 4. A 3. igénypont szerinti eljárás foganatosítási mód­ja, azzal jellemezve, hogy a háttér memóriákat, pl. diszk, mágnesszalagos egység, közvetlenül a belső központi vezetékkötegre kapcsoljuk, oly módon, hogy azok az adatforgalmukat a szabad időközökben bonyolítsák le. 5. A 3. vagy 4. igénypont szerinti eljárás foganatosí­tási módja, azzal jellemezve, hogy a holt időben a belső központi vezetékkötegen blokkos műveleteket előnyö­sen adatrendezést vagy mátrix műveleteket végzünk. 6. Az 1—5. igénypontok bármelyike szerinti eljárás foganatosítási módja, azzal jellemezve, hogy a belső központi vezetékköteget úgy alakítjuk ki, hogy a cím­vezetékeinek száma nagyobb legyen, mint a számítógép-, illetve az egységes központi vezetékkötegek címveze­­tékeinek a száma. 7. Berendezés központi egység független memória-5 10 15 20 25 30 35 40 45 50 55 60 65 4

Next

/
Thumbnails
Contents